attractive looking pub from exterior so was naturally drawn off the bus at the stop outside,its a marstons pub with very limited ale choice (marstons pedigree and banks's original) opted for the uninspiring pint of pedigree however @£2.40 was quite reasonable,very good value food menu aswell including Sunday roasts for just £4.95 6/10
